Agent Xcelerator is a customer-specific training and support program designed to build internal AI agent development skills within an organisation. During the program, participants learn how to design, build, and manage Microsoft Copilot Studio agents through a practical, hands-on approach, while developing solutions tailored to their organization’s real and current business needs.
The program is a goal-oriented learning journey that combines theory with workshops, a hackathon, support clinics, and the development of participants’ own agents.

Course contentTraining Sessions
Each session is delivered by two instructors, making the training more interactive and ensuring that questions are actively answered in the chat.
Module 1: Kickoff and Introduction to Copilot Agents / Online, 1.5 hours
- Introduction to the Agent Xcelerator program
- Overview of different Copilot agents
Module 2: Fundamentals of Building Copilot Studio Agents / Online, 1.5 hours
- Best practices for agent design
- Copilot Studio user interface
- Using tools and data sources within agents
Module 3: Fundamentals of Agent Governance / Online, 1.5 hours
- Best practices for managing agents, environments, and solutions
- Lifecycle management and deployment pipelines
- Testing and evaluation
We recommend that your organization’s Power Platform governance lead participates in this session.
Module 4: Agentic Workflows / Online, 1.5 hours
- Creating agentic workflows
- Invoking workflows from agents
- Introduction to Power Automate
Module 5: Copilot Studio Agent Workshop / Hands-on, On-site, 3 hours
- Building and refining agents with guided support
- Creating your own sample agent
- Designing your team’s agent for the hackathon
Module 6: Advanced Copilot Studio Features / Online, 2 hours
- Fundamentals of building autonomous agents
- Agent orchestration (calling other agents)
- Introduction to MCP servers and Microsoft Foundry
